Deputy Chairperson, I move without notice:
That the Council -
1) notes the callous and blatant acts of public violence displayed by disgruntled members of the flagging Congress of the People as they threw chairs and exchanged blows after a lengthy disagreement over the credentials during the party's Gauteng provincial congress in Vereeniging;
2) further notes that five people sustained various degrees of injuries and senior party members were forced to flee through the windows of the Assemblies of God hall, as party members engaged in a rat-chasing exercise of the current party leader Mbhazima Shilowa who was booed off the podium when he tried to address delegates; and
3) acknowledges that these are some of the last kicks of the party, as it battles rowdy and disgruntled political cowboys that left the ANC for selfish political gain.
